Before You Purchase a Computer Speaker: Essential Considerations
When the built-in speakers on your monitor or laptop just aren’t cutting it, or you’re tired of tangled cables and bulky components taking over your workspace, that’s usually the cue to start looking for dedicated computer speakers. They promise to solve these woes by delivering clearer, louder, and richer audio, transforming your digital experience from mundane to engaging.
The ideal customer for a compact, simple computer speaker system is someone who values a clean, minimalist desk setup, often working or studying from home, watching videos, or engaging in casual gaming. They need reliable sound for daily use, prefer simplicity over complex features, and want to avoid the clutter of multiple cables. This product category is also perfect for laptop users who want a significant audio upgrade without sacrificing portability.
However, these types of speakers aren’t for everyone. If you’re an audiophile seeking pristine, high-fidelity sound with expansive soundstages and deep, rumbling sub-bass, or a hardcore gamer who demands precise 7.1 surround sound and a built-in microphone for competitive play, a basic soundbar won’t meet your expectations. Similarly, if you primarily use your speakers with devices other than computers, such as smart TVs, gaming consoles, or projectors, you’ll need to double-check compatibility, as many USB-powered speakers are optimized specifically for PCs. Instead, these users might consider dedicated 2.1 or 5.1 channel systems, premium soundbars with optical or HDMI ARC inputs, or high-end gaming headsets.
Before making a purchase, you should consider several key factors: connectivity (USB, 3.5mm, Bluetooth), sound quality expectations (do you need deep bass, clear highs, or just louder volume?), form factor (traditional 2.0 speakers, soundbar, clip-on), desk space availability, and any desired additional features like a built-in microphone or physical volume controls. Thinking through these points will help ensure you choose the right audio solution for your specific needs.

Extensive FULL COMPATIBILITY & The Nuance of NO VOLUME BUTTONS
The Computer Speakers for Desktop PC Monitor boasts impressive compatibility, having been proven by countless users across various operating systems. It functions flawlessly as an external speaker for Windows PCs (7/8/10/11), macOS, Chrome OS, and Linux laptops and desktop computers. This broad compatibility ensures that no matter your preferred operating system, the XKX speakers will likely integrate effortlessly into your setup, providing a consistent and reliable audio upgrade.
However, this feature section also brings us to a minor but important consideration: the intentional absence of physical volume control buttons on the speaker itself. This design choice means that you adjust the volume exclusively through your computer’s system settings. While some users might initially find this inconvenient, it actually simplifies the speaker’s hardware and, for many, offers a more streamlined control experience. It means you only have one volume setting to manage (on your computer), rather than juggling both system volume and a separate speaker volume knob. From a long-term user perspective, I’ve grown accustomed to it; it maintains system-wide volume consistency and keeps the speaker’s design exceptionally clean.
A significant point regarding compatibility and power is that these speakers are specifically designed for computers. They are not recommended for TVs, TV-Boxes, projectors, Xbox, PlayStation, iPads, or tablets. The reason provided by the manufacturer is crucial: the USB ports on these other devices often do not provide sufficient electric power to adequately drive the speaker, which can lead to reduced maximum volume levels or even audio distortion and cut-outs, especially at higher volumes. Similarly, while convenient, connecting the XKX speakers to a USB hub is also not recommended for the same power supply reasons. These limitations are important to note, ensuring that prospective buyers understand the intended use case and avoid potential frustration with unsupported devices. This focused compatibility, while a disadvantage for some, underscores its optimization as a dedicated computer audio solution.
